BACTRIM ® DS TABLETS AND BACTRIM ® ORAL SUSPENSION _PRONOUNCED BACK-TRIM_ _contains the active ingredients sulfamethoxazole and trimethoprim_ CONSUMER MEDICINE INFORMATION WHAT IS IN THIS LEAFLET This leaflet answers some common questions about BACTRIM DS tablets and BACTRIM oral suspension (mixture is another name that can be used instead of oral suspension). It does not contain all the available information. It does not take the place of talking to your doctor or pharmacist. All medicines have risks and benefits. Your doctor has weighed the risks of you taking BACTRIM against the benefits they expect it will have for you. IF YOU HAVE ANY CONCERNS ABOUT TAKING THIS MEDICINE, ASK YOUR DOCTOR OR PHARMACIST. KEEP THIS LEAFLET WITH THE MEDICINE. You may need to read it again. WHAT BACTRIM IS USED FOR BACTRIM contains the active ingredients sulfamethoxazole and trimethoprim, also known as co- trimoxazole. BACTRIM is used to treat bacterial infections in different parts of the body. BACTRIM belongs to a group of medicines called antibiotics. There are many different types of medicines used to treat bacterial infections. Sulfamethoxazole in BACTRIM belongs to a group of medicines known as sulfonamides. Trimethoprim belongs to a group of medicines known as the benzylpyrimidines. BACTRIM works by stopping the growth of the bacteria causing the infection. BACTRIM does not work against infections caused by viruses, such as colds and flu. BACTRIM has been prescribed for your current infection. Another infection later on may require a different medicine. Your doctor may have prescribed BACTRIM for another purpose. ASK YOUR DOCTOR IF YOU HAVE ANY QUESTIONS WHY BACTRIM HAS BEEN PRESCRIBED FOR YOU. This medicine is available only with a doctor's prescription. AUSTRALIAN PRODUCT INFORMATION BACTRIM ® (SULFAMETHOXAZOLE/TRIMETHOPRIM) Bactrim 180911 1 1. NAME OF THE MEDICINE Sulfamethoxazole/trimethoprim 2. QUALITATIVE AND QUANTITATIVE COMPOSITION Bactrim DS tablets contain 800mg sulfamethoxazole and 160mg trimethoprim. Bactrim oral suspension contains 200mg sulfamethoxazole and 40mg trimethoprim per 5mL Excipients with known effect Bactrim oral suspension contains sorbitol 63% w/v For the full list of excipients, see section 6.1 List of excipients. 3. PHARMACEUTICAL FORM Bactrim DS tablets are white to almost white, oblong, with a breakline on one side and "ROCHE 800 + 160" on the other side. Bactrim oral suspension is light beige in colour with a banana flavor. 4. CLINICAL PARTICULARS 4.1 THERAPEUTIC INDICATIONS Upper and lower respiratory tract infections; renal and urinary tract infections; genital tract infections; gastrointestinal tract infections; skin and wound infections; septicaemias and other infections caused by sensitive organisms. 4.2 DOSE AND METHOD OF ADMINISTRATION DOSAGE In acute infections Bactrim (in any form) should be given for at least five days or until the patient has been symptom-free for two days. Adults and children over 12 years of age _Standard dosage. _ One Bactrim DS (double strength) tablet morning and evening after meals. Minimum dosage: half a Bactrim DS (double strength) tablet twice daily (see below). Maximum dosage (for particularly severe infections): One and a half Bactrim DS (double strength) tablets twice daily. The recommended dose for patients with documented Pneumocystis jirovecii pneumonitis is 20 mg/kg trimethoprim and 100 mg/kg sulfamethoxazole/24 hours given in equally divided doses every six hours for 14 days.
